Optimise drivetrain weight with the XRAY 305933 narrow pinion

For builders aiming to trim rotating mass, the XRAY 305933 Narrow Pinion Gear is made from aircraft-grade duralumin and measures 1.5mm thinner while being 25% lighter than standard pinions, giving a measurable edge in acceleration and efficiency.

High precision machining for tight tolerances

Each pinion is produced on XRAY's specialised gear machines to ensure concentricity and minimal runout. These tight tolerances reduce drivetrain noise and help maintain consistent meshing under race conditions.

Hardcoat treatment and chamfered edges

After machining, edges are chamfered and a durable hardcoat is applied to protect the gear profile. The treatment helps retain form and lowers wear, supporting smooth operation when matched with compatible spur gears.

Plug-and-play fitment for 48 pitch systems

The XRAY 305933 comes ready to install and works with a variety of 48 pitch spurs, making it a straightforward upgrade for racers and weekend hobbyists who want immediate gains without extra prep.

Any RC car or buggy that specifies 48 pitch gearing can accept this pinion, including many 1/10 and 1/12 competition electrics. Check your gearbox spec before fitting.
The 1.5mm reduction and duralumin material strike a balance between lightness and strength, while the hardcoat helps maintain durability for typical racing loads.
The gear ships ready to use, but always check mesh with your spur and adjust shimming or motor position to achieve correct backlash for quiet operation.
